Cloud Computing Engineers-Responsibilities-Cloud Certifications

Cloud computing engineers play a pivotal role in designing, implementing, and maintaining cloud-based solutions for organizations. Cloud technologies are increasing day by day and most of the technology companies are adopting cloud computing and cloud environment so the demand of cloud computing engineers is also increasing.

Cloud Computing Engineers-Responsibilities-Cloud Certifications
Cloud Computing Engineers-Responsibilities-Cloud Certifications

Cloud computing engineers play a pivotal role in designing, implementing, and maintaining cloud-based solutions for organizations. Cloud technologies are increasing day by day and most of the technology companies are adopting cloud computing and cloud environment so the demand of cloud computing engineers is also increasing. Cloud computing professionals are instrumental in harnessing the power of cloud platforms to enhance scalability, efficiency, and innovation.

In my previous articles on HR Managers, IT Network EngineersDevOps EngineersBusiness Analysts in IT industryIT Delivery ManagersProject ManagersTest ManagersProgram Managers, and IT Managers etc., you can review their roles and responsibilities and certifications needed for their respective domains to enhance your knowledge in the respective fields.

In this article, I’ll briefly explain the roles and responsibilities of cloud computing engineers along with the cloud computing certifications which may help to understand the domain specific knowledge and keep them Up-to-date with the current industry trends and latest technologies.

Roles and Responsibilities of Cloud Computing Engineers

1. Cloud Architecture Design

Cloud computing engineers are responsible for designing scalable, reliable, and secure cloud architectures. This involves selecting appropriate cloud services, defining network configurations, and ensuring compatibility with organizational requirements.

2. Infrastructure as Code (IaC)

Leveraging IaC tools such as Terraform or AWS CloudFormation, cloud engineers automate the provisioning and management of infrastructure, ensuring consistency and efficiency.

3. Cloud Service Selection

Evaluating and selecting cloud services based on specific project requirements. This includes choosing between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S) offerings.

4. Deployment and Configuration Management

Managing the deployment of applications and services on cloud platforms, and configuring them for optimal performance. This may involve using tools like Kubernetes for container orchestration.

5. Security Implementation

Implementing robust security measures to protect cloud-based resources. This includes configuring access controls, encryption, and monitoring for potential security threats.

6. Cost Optimization

Monitoring and optimizing cloud costs by implementing cost-efficient practices and selecting appropriate pricing models. Cloud engineers strive to maximize value while minimizing expenses.

7. Performance Monitoring and Optimization

Utilizing monitoring tools to track the performance of cloud-based systems. Engineers identify bottlenecks, optimize resource allocation, and ensure efficient use of cloud resources.

8. Disaster Recovery Planning

Developing and implementing disaster recovery strategies to ensure business continuity in the event of data loss or system failures.

9. Collaboration with DevOps Teams

Collaborating with DevOps teams to integrate cloud solutions seamlessly into the continuous integration and continuous deployment (CI/CD) pipeline.

10. Adopting DevSecOps Practices

Integrating security practices into the development and operations lifecycle, emphasizing proactive security measures throughout the cloud environment.

11. Migration to the Cloud

Assisting in the migration of on-premises infrastructure to the cloud, ensuring a smooth transition and minimal disruption to operations.

12. Vendor Management

Engaging with cloud service providers, managing relationships, and staying informed about updates and new features offered by cloud platforms.

13. Capacity Planning

Anticipating future resource requirements and planning for scalability. Cloud engineers ensure that the infrastructure can handle increasing workloads.

14. Training and Documentation

Providing training to teams on best practices for cloud usage and maintaining comprehensive documentation for cloud configurations and procedures.

15. Staying Current with Cloud Trends

Remaining informed about emerging technologies and trends in cloud computing, and assessing their potential impact on organizational strategies.

In conclusion, cloud computing engineers are essential in transforming traditional IT infrastructures into agile, scalable, and secure cloud-based environments. Their expertise contributes to the successful adoption of cloud technologies, enabling organizations to innovate, scale, and adapt in the dynamic landscape of modern IT.

Cloud Computing Certifications

1. AWS Certified Solutions Architect – Associate

Issued by Amazon Web Services (AWS), AWS Certified Solutions Architect-Associate certification validates skills in designing distributed systems and applications on the AWS platform.

2. Microsoft Certified Azure Solutions Architect Expert

Provided by Microsoft, Microsoft Certified Azure Solutions Architect Expert expert-level certification focuses on designing and implementing solutions that run on Microsoft Azure.

3. Google Cloud Professional Cloud Architect

Issued by Google Cloud, Google Cloud Professional Cloud Architect certification is for architects and engineers who design and manage scalable and secure Google Cloud solutions.

4. CompTIA Cloud+

Offered by CompTIA, Cloud+ is a vendor-neutral certification covering cloud concepts, virtualization, and implementation.

5. Certified Cloud Security Professional (CCSP)

Issued by (ISC)², CCSP certifies expertise in cloud security, covering topics such as data security, identity management, and compliance.

6. Professional Cloud Administrator

Provided by the Cloud Credential Council (CCC), Professional Cloud Administrator is an admin level certification covering cloud technologies, architecture, and adoption for the 2-5 years of cloud administrators.

7. Cisco Certified Network Associate (CCNA) Cloud

Offered by Cisco, CCNA Cloud validates skills in cloud infrastructure, cloud technologies, and network fundamentals.

8. VMware-Cloud Management and Automation 2023 (VCP-CMA)

Issued by VMware, VMware Certified Professional – Cloud Management and Automation 2023 (VCP-CMA) certification exam validates ability to install, configure, administer, and operate VMware Aria Automation to support the self-service and automated provisioning of services into Private, Public and Multi-Cloud environments.

9. IBM Cloud Advanced Architect

Provided by IBM, IBM Cloud Advanced Architect certification validates skills in designing, planning, and architecting cloud solutions.

10. Red Hat Certified Specialist in Cloud Infrastructure

Issued by Red Hat, Red Hat Certified Specialist in Cloud Infrastructure certification is for professionals who design and manage Red Hat solutions in a cloud environment.

11. Certified OpenStack Administrator (COA)

Offered by the OpenStack Foundation, COA certifies skills in deploying, managing, and troubleshooting OpenStack clouds.

12. Salesforce Certified Technical Architect (CTA)

Provided by Salesforce, CTA is the pinnacle of Salesforce certifications, validating expertise in designing complex, scalable, and secure solutions on the Salesforce platform.

13. Oracle Cloud Infrastructure 2023 Certified Architect Associate

Issued by Oracle, Oracle Cloud Infrastructure 2023 Certified Architect Associate (OCI2023CAA) certification is for professionals who design and implement OCI solutions.

14. Certified Kubernetes Administrator (CKA)

Provided by the Cloud Native Computing Foundation (CNCF), CKA certifies proficiency in Kubernetes administration.

15. AWS Certified DevOps Engineer-Professional

Issued by AWS, AWS Certified DevOps Engineer-Professional certification focuses on DevOps practices in the AWS environment.

These certifications cater to different aspects of cloud computing, including architecture, security, operations, and platform-specific skills. As organizations increasingly move their infrastructure to the cloud, professionals with these certifications are well-positioned to meet the demands of the evolving IT landscape.

Image credit- Pixabay

Get real time updates directly on you device, subscribe now.

2 Comments
  1. […] Cloud Computing Engineers-Responsibilities-Cloud Certifications […]

  2. […] Cloud Computing Engineers-Responsibilities-Cloud Certifications […]

Comments are closed.